| Last Head to Head Matchup | UM-Morris ran its winning streak against Martin Luther to six games in its last match-up against the Knights, a 88-78 victory. The win gave the Cougars its first winning season (14-13) since the 1996-97 season. Six Cougar players were in double figures on the night, with Jon Lange leading the way with 17 points on a perfect six-for-six from the floor. Center Tom Engelbrecht led the Knights with 25 points, with guard Dan Unke adding 19. |

| Knights Notes | The Knights will be looking to stay in the thick of
things in the UMAC and will be riding the hot hands of senior guard
Dan Unke and the up-and-coming freshman Jake Schwartz.
Schwartz has scored a combined 31 points in the last two games.
Unke eclipsed the 1,000 career point mark in the win against St.
Scholastica and has moved into fifth all-time with 1,021 points.
UM-Morris is on a five-game winning streak and currently sits at # 1
